The History of Sugar Cane Growing



Although sugar cane growing go back hundreds of years, its origins can be traced to the exotic regions of Southeast Asia, where early farmers initially acknowledged the plant's sweet sap. This exploration caused the cultivation of sugar cane as a staple plant, gradually spreading out to India and the Center East. By the very first millennium advertisement, sugar cane was being grown in these regions, where techniques for removing and improving sugar were developed.The plant acquired importance in Europe during the Crusades, as returning soldiers brought knowledge of sugar production back home. By the 15th century, the establishment of sugar plantations started in the Caribbean, driven by the need for sugar in Europe. The transatlantic slave labor fueled this growth, as oppressed labor was made use of to maximize production. Over centuries, sugar cane growing progressed, influencing economic situations and cultures worldwide, making it a considerable agricultural product.


Expanding Problems and Agricultural Practices





The effective growing of sugar walking cane depends greatly on certain growing problems and agricultural techniques. Perfect temperature levels range between 20 to 32 degrees Celsius, with well-distributed rainfall of 1,500 to 2,500 millimeters annually. Soil high quality is crucial; loamy or sandy dirts, abundant in natural matter, promote healthy growth.Farmers often utilize numerous agricultural methods to enhance return. Plant rotation and intercropping are typical approaches to preserve dirt fertility and control insects. Routine watering might be essential in drier regions, making certain that the plants get ample moisture. Fertilization, especially with nitrogen and potassium, is crucial for robust growth.Pest and weed monitoring strategies, including integrated pest management (IPM), help to lessen losses. Sustainable techniques, such as minimal tillage and natural farming, are acquiring grip amongst manufacturers to secure the environment. Collectively, these elements add significantly to the successful production of sugar walking cane.

Optimum Collecting Timing



Selecting the appropriate moment to collect sugar cane greatly influences both yield and quality. Perfect gathering normally occurs when the walking cane gets to full maturity, typically in between 12 to 18 months after growing. At this stage, sucrose levels optimal, making certain the finest sugar removal prices. Weather additionally play a crucial duty; collecting during completely dry durations can prevent damages to the walking cane and reduce dirt compaction. Additionally, checking the plant's color and fallen leave decrease can show preparedness, as a yellowing of the leaves recommends that the cane is ripe. Prompt harvesting is crucial, as hold-ups can cause decreased sugar web content and enhanced susceptibility to pests and conditions, inevitably affecting total production efficiency.

Refining Refine Explained



Refining sugar from the extracted juice is a crucial step that improves its pureness and quality. This procedure involves numerous stages, starting with clarification. The juice is warmed and treated with lime and various other representatives to eliminate impurities, resulting in a clearer fluid. Next, the cleared up juice undergoes evaporation, where water is eliminated to concentrate the sugar material. The concentrated syrup is after that crystallized by cooling, enabling sugar crystals to create. These crystals are separated from the staying syrup, referred to as molasses, with centrifugation. The raw sugar is additional refined via cleaning, purification, and drying out, which removes any remaining contaminations. The end item is the granulated sugar typically made use of in families and sectors worldwide, making certain consistency and sweet taste.
